Hands-on Faith for Families – Week of February 5, 2024 

Theme: Work Together 

You Can Work as a Family to Serve Others 

Scripture: Each one should use whatever gift he has received to serve others, faithfully administering God’s grace in its various forms (1 Peter 4:10). 

PlayIn one minute, name as many parts of a car and what they do as you can (headlights give light so we can see where we're going, wheels hold up the car and help it move forward, etc.). 

Talk: The Bible says that the body of Christ — the people who serve God — is made of many parts (1 Corinthians 12). Each part is designed by God with a particular purpose. Just like different parts of our car work together to help it run, we can combine our unique talents and abilities to serve others as a family. In 1 Peter 4:10, the Bible says, Each one should use whatever gift he has received to serve others. How can our family work together to serve others in our church and community? 

PrayAsk God to help you see the needs around you and respond as a family who serves others well.   Christi Lynn
